Understanding the Environmental Footprint of PET Bottles

To understand the changes, it’s important to first look at the key environmental concerns associated with PET bottle production and disposal.

1. Raw Material Usage

Traditional PET bottles are made from petroleum-based resources. Extracting and refining these materials contribute to carbon emissions and resource depletion. This dependency on non-renewable resources has pushed pet bottle manufacturers to explore alternatives like bio-based PET and recycled PET (rPET).

2. Energy Consumption

PET bottle manufacturing requires significant energy for melting, molding, and shaping the plastic. Energy-intensive production not only increases costs but also adds to greenhouse gas emissions if fossil fuels are used as the main power source.

3. Plastic Waste and Pollution

One of the major environmental issues is the improper disposal of PET bottles. When not recycled properly, they end up in landfills or oceans, taking hundreds of years to decompose. This leads to microplastic pollution that threatens marine life and ecosystems.

4. Transportation Emissions

Since PET bottles are lightweight, they help reduce shipping emissions compared to heavier materials like glass. However, the large-scale global transport of raw materials and finished bottles still contributes to overall carbon emissions.

How PET Bottle Manufacturers Are Changing the Narrative

Over the past decade, pet bottle manufacturers have made impressive strides toward sustainability. They’re rethinking every stage of production—from raw material selection to recycling and waste management—to create eco-friendly solutions that align with global environmental goals.

1. Adopting Recycled PET (rPET)

Recycled PET, or rPET, is a game-changer in reducing environmental impact. Instead of producing bottles from virgin plastic, manufacturers are using plastic waste collected from consumers and recycling facilities.

rPET production uses up to 75% less energy compared to new PET and significantly reduces greenhouse gas emissions. Moreover, many brands are now pledging to use bottles made with 50–100% recycled material, making circular packaging a reality.

2. Introducing Bio-Based PET

Another major innovation is the development of bio-based PET, made from renewable resources like sugarcane or corn. These materials reduce dependency on fossil fuels while maintaining the same quality and recyclability as traditional PET.

By combining bio-based PET with rPET, pet bottle manufacturers can create packaging that’s both sustainable and fully recyclable—without sacrificing durability or clarity.

3. Lightweight Bottle Design

Lightweighting has become a key strategy in sustainable manufacturing. By using less plastic per bottle, pet bottle manufacturers reduce material consumption, energy use, and transport emissions.

For example, a modern 500 ml PET water bottle can weigh up to 30% less than its predecessor from a decade ago—without compromising strength or performance. This innovation directly contributes to lower carbon emissions.

4. Improved Recycling Technologies

The rise of advanced recycling methods such as chemical recycling and closed-loop systems is transforming the industry. Chemical recycling breaks PET down to its original components, allowing it to be reused indefinitely.

Pet bottle manufacturers are partnering with recycling facilities to ensure that post-consumer bottles are collected, processed, and turned back into new products. This circular approach prevents bottles from ending up in landfills or oceans and ensures valuable materials are reused efficiently.

5. Energy Efficiency and Renewable Power

To further cut emissions, many manufacturers are investing in energy-efficient machinery and renewable energy sources. Modern PET plants now use solar power, wind energy, and energy recovery systems to minimize their carbon footprint.

Additionally, smart automation helps monitor and optimize energy consumption throughout production, ensuring maximum efficiency with minimal waste.

6. Waste Reduction and Closed-Loop Systems

In a traditional linear model, bottles are made, used, and discarded. However, pet bottle manufacturers are increasingly adopting closed-loop systems, where waste materials from one stage are recycled and reintroduced into production.

This reduces raw material demand, saves resources, and ensures that production remains sustainable and economically viable in the long term.

7. Eco-Friendly Additives and Labeling

Labels and bottle caps also play a role in sustainability. Manufacturers are now using biodegradable adhesives, recyclable caps, and eco-friendly inks. These small innovations make the recycling process smoother and more efficient.

FAQs

Q1: Are PET bottles environmentally friendly? Yes. PET bottles are 100% recyclable and can be reused multiple times when processed correctly. The challenge lies in proper disposal and recycling infrastructure.

Q2: How are pet bottle manufacturers reducing plastic waste? Manufacturers are using recycled materials, lightweight designs, and closed-loop recycling systems to minimize waste and environmental impact.

Q3: What is the difference between PET and rPET? PET is made from virgin plastic derived from petroleum, while rPET is made from recycled PET materials. rPET production uses less energy and reduces carbon emissions.

Q4: Are bio-based PET bottles biodegradable? No, bio-based PET bottles aren’t biodegradable, but they are fully recyclable and made from renewable resources, reducing dependency on fossil fuels.

Q5: What can consumers do to help? Consumers can support sustainability by recycling PET bottles, avoiding single-use plastics, and choosing products packaged in recycled or eco-friendly materials.
